Schema cache poisoning via unnormalized resource URI
Published Feb 18, 2022 · Updated Aug 2, 2024
Path traversal in LemMinX before 0.19.0 allows remote attackers to poison cached external schema files through a crafted resource URI. CacheResourcesManager derived the cache path directly from an unnormalized external-resource URI, allowing dot-dot segments to select a different cache location. Processing an attacker-controlled external resource URI is required, and the resulting overwrite can make later schema resolution use attacker-supplied cache content.
